- Canada
-
FIRST CANADA TO GREAT BRITAIN SHORTWAVE LINK. ALL BRASS WORK WAS CUT, DRILLED TAPPED & ASSEMBLED LOCALLY ACCORDING TO WILFRED ROGER WHO STARTED WORK IN OCT. 1925(?) WITH THE MARCONI CO. IN DRUMMONDVILLE, QUEBEC. - Function
-
Used to supply regulated DC power to a transmitter. - Technical
-
ONE OF THE FIRST COMMERCIAL SW TRANSMITTERS - Area Notes
